under what conditions of temperature and pressure would you expect gases to obey the ideal-gas equation?

Answers

Answer:

Gases obey the ideal-gas law at high temperatures and low pressures.

Why are yeast good organisms for studying natural selection?

Answers

Yeast are good organisms for studying natural selection, because they reproduce very quickly.

The change in a population's heritable features over generations is a major evolutionary mechanism. The yeast are good organisms for studying natural selection because they can reproduce quickly.

What is natural selection?

The natural selection is defined as the mechanism through which living creature populations adapt and change. It states that the organisms which are able to survive and reproduce with the changing environment conditions are selected by nature.

The species which are not possible to survive are eliminated. The genes responsible for the survival of an organism are passed on to the successive generations.

Yeast is ideal for laboratory evolution experiments due to its short generation time and the separate haploid and diploid phases of its life cycle. It is cheap, its genetic material is easy to manipulate and it also grows quickly. Yeast cells are a good model organism.
